notaz.gp2x.de
/
pcsx_rearmed.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
(from parent 1:
50d8dac
)
Merge pull request #561 from gameblabla/sony_armored_fix_libretro
author
gameblabla
<gameblabla@users.noreply.github.com>
Sat, 2 Oct 2021 02:39:36 +0000
(
02:39
+0000)
committer
GitHub
<noreply@github.com>
Sat, 2 Oct 2021 02:39:36 +0000
(
02:39
+0000)
Fix for Armored Core misdetecting a Link cable being detected
libpcsxcore/psxhw.c
patch
|
blob
|
blame
|
history
diff --git
a/libpcsxcore/psxhw.c
b/libpcsxcore/psxhw.c
index
c90f8c7
..
5981ee5
100644
(file)
--- a/
libpcsxcore/psxhw.c
+++ b/
libpcsxcore/psxhw.c
@@
-123,7
+123,14
@@
u16 psxHwRead16(u32 add) {
return hard;
case 0x1f80105e:
hard = SIO1_readBaud16();
- return hard;
\r
+ return hard;
+#else
+ /* Fixes Armored Core misdetecting the Link cable being detected.
+ * We want to turn that thing off and force it to do local multiplayer instead.
+ * Thanks Sony for the fix, they fixed it in their PS Classic fork.
+ */
+ case 0x1f801054:
+ return 0x80;
\r
#endif
case 0x1f801100:
hard = psxRcntRcount(0);